Ingredients
2salmon steaks1 inch thick
1/2tspceltic sea salt
1/4tspcoarsely ground pepper
1egg white
40gmacadamia nutschopped
20mlolive oilextra virgin
1dessertspoonpure butter
8tspminced fresh parsley
20mlfresh lemon juice
Instructions
Sprinkle fish with salt and pepper. In a shallow bowl, whisk egg white until frothy. Dip fish in egg white, then coat with nuts. Gently push nut mixture into fish.
Heat a skillet and add oil. When hot turn to medium heat and add the fish, cook for about 4-6 minutes on each side or until fish flakes easily with a fork. Should be slightly pink inside.
Melt butter and stir in parsley and lemon juice – pour over fish and remove from heat – rest for 1 minute and serve with fresh salad.
